  3. Hey there! I went fishing with my uncle last week, and it was around 2:30pm. It was almost cloudless, and it was very hot. We had been fishing tight cover, and we had nothing, we decided to move out deeper, around 10' to 12'. We started smoking them on a slow moving plastic, and we landed a couple 3 pounders. Try this out, and also in a cold over-cast day, this worked. I hope I helped. Good luck 8-)

  9. This is what I have been doing the last few weeks. I have caught many but nothing over a pound and a half. The last time I was out I was doing this on a hot day at the local lake, again caught a few small ones. We headed for the dock for a small break and I was watching these two guys throwing crankbaits in about 10 foot of water right out in the open. I saw one catch a 3 1/2 pounder and not 2 minutes latere the other caught a 5 pounder! I then went over the area after they left it with my fish finder. I saw no structure or chanels. So ya just never know! I hope to go back this week and give the crankbaits a shot there. I'll let ya know how it worked.
